Types of Tuna Species and Their Habitats

Tuna species come in various forms. Common types include bluefin, yellowfin, and skipjack tuna. They inhabit the open oceans and prefer warm waters, often migrating long distances. Each species has its unique requirements for breeding and feeding. Some tend to stay near the surface, while others dive deeper. Understanding their habitats is vital for effective stock management. Their vast ranges make managing populations quite challenging.

Role of Tuna in the Marine Ecosystem

Tuna play a critical role in maintaining the marine ecosystem. They are top predators, which means they help control the populations of smaller fish. This balance is crucial for healthy ocean environments. When tuna populations decline due to overfishing, it can lead to negative effects throughout the food web. Their decline impacts not just other fish but also marine mammals that rely on them for survival. Protecting these species is essential for marine health.

Overfishing occurs when fish populations are caught at a rate that exceeds their natural ability to reproduce. This relentless harvesting leads to severe consequences for marine life. It isn’t just the tuna that suffers; entire ecosystems face disruption.

Recent studies show alarming statistical data on the decline of tuna populations. In certain regions, stocks have plummeted by as much as 70% over the last fifty years. Such numbers clearly illustrate a dangerous trend. If current practices continue, there is a real threat that some tuna species could face extinction.

Managing tuna fisheries in Open Waters requires the cooperation of multiple nations. One key organization in this effort is the International Commission for the Conservation of Atlantic Tunas (ICCAT). This entity plays a significant role in overseeing fishing activity, helping to maintain the balance of marine ecosystems.

Current regulations include the establishment of fishing quotas and limitations on catch sizes. These measures aim to address overfishing and promote sustainability. While some countries follow these rules diligently, compliance varies widely across different nations. This inconsistency can undermine efforts for preservation and stock management.

Enforcement of regulations remains a substantial challenge. Many fleets operate in international waters where oversight is scarce. As a result, illegal fishing practices can flourish. Bycatch, which refers to the capture of unintended species, complicates this further, harming both fish populations and their habitats.

ICCAT has initiated various conservation efforts to mitigate these issues. They advocate for better practices and share data among member nations. Despite these efforts, gaps in regulation and enforcement persist. Nations often prioritize their economic impact over environmental concerns, leading to conflicts in policy implementation.

Fishing Quotas and Their Role

Fishing quotas are limits set on how much fish can be caught during a specific time period. Their purpose is to manage fish populations and promote sustainability. By controlling the amount of tuna harvested, quotas help prevent overfishing. This means more fish can reproduce, supporting the overall health of the marine ecosystem.

Setting these quotas is not a simple task. Various factors must be considered, like fish population sizes and health. International regulations often guide these decisions, but conflicts can arise between different countries. Many nations rely on tuna for food and income, making compromises difficult. Enforcement is another challenge. Monitoring who catches what in open waters can be tricky. Limited resources for surveillance mean that some fishermen may exceed their quotas without facing consequences.

Local fishing communities feel the impact of these quotas in many ways. On one hand, quotas help protect fish stocks crucial for their livelihoods. On the other hand, strict limits can lead to decreased income. Fewer fish available means less profit for fishermen. This economic impact can strain families and local businesses dependent on the fishing industry. Bycatch, or the unintended catch of other species, often complicates these issues further. Conservation efforts aimed at protecting vulnerable species can affect overall catch limits, adding pressure to already struggling communities.

Definition and Implications of Bycatch

Bycatch refers to the unintended fish and other marine animals caught during fishing. This problem occurs across many fishing methods, often harming species that are already vulnerable. It can include everything from dolphins to sea turtles. The implications are serious; not only do affected populations decline, but entire marine ecosystems can start to suffer. When these non-target species are caught, it can disrupt the balance of the ocean environment. Long-term sustainability becomes difficult as the health of many stocks is compromised.

Strategies to Reduce Bycatch in Tuna Fishing

Efforts to reduce bycatch must be a top priority. One effective approach involves improving fishing gear. By using more selective nets or developing special hooks, unintended captures can be minimized. Additionally, implementing international regulations on fishing quotas can help maintain healthy stock management. Monitoring bycatch rates can also provide valuable data for conservation efforts. Habitat protection can further support the recovery of affected species. All of these strategies rely on cooperation among fishermen, scientists, and governments. Role of marine protected areas in habitat protection

Marine protected areas (MPAs) offer refuge for various species. These zones help restore habitats by limiting human activity. By protecting critical breeding grounds, we can aid tuna recovery. Additionally, MPAs help reduce bycatch, which is when other marine life gets caught unintentionally. Healthy ecosystems are supported through the protection of these areas. Establishing MPAs can also create economic opportunities. Local communities benefit from sustainable tourism rather than overfishing.
